Hi The Third Pope, Thank you for the donation. Jack up vehicle and put on stand. Remove the front wheel. Remove CV shaft central nut. ( 36 mm socket box and impact wrench) Remove brake caliper and mount ( 12 mm, 14 mm and 17 mm ring or socket) Pull hub out slightly to enable lug bolts to be installed. ( Universal puller, hammer type) Knock out lugs to be replaced and install new lug bolts. Use lug nut to tighten to press the lugs into position. Reverse removal procedures.
